Transaction 681a9396371ec336594fcf426749f3752e4a810efcdbe40e289ad112cd2c04dd

2 Input
2 Outputs
  • 681a9396371ec336594fcf426749f3752e4a810efcdbe40e289ad112cd2c04dd:0
  • value  3799900000
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Y
  • 681a9396371ec336594fcf426749f3752e4a810efcdbe40e289ad112cd2c04dd:1
  • value  1567096115
    address  1FRCAsP1c12HCjgGdTYDgwLnrwyA6dFwRE